
Stockbridge Apartments ALL UTILITIES INCLUDED
3328 Euclid Ave, Cleveland, OH 44115
Studio - 1 Bed $695 - $1,150
All Filters
1,201 Apartments Available
3328 Euclid Ave, Cleveland, OH 44115
Studio - 1 Bed $695 - $1,150
2669 Euclid Heights Blvd, Cleveland, OH 44106
1 Bed $795 - $975
11311 Shaker Blvd, Cleveland, OH 44104
1 - 2 Beds $637 - $740
2590 N Moreland Blvd, Shaker Heights, OH 44120
1 Bed $925